21 results found for "80112

"

Quality Suites Tech Center South

7374 South Clinton Street, Englewood, CO, 80112

Phone: (303)858-0700

Tags: Motels,

View Quality Suites Tech Center South map & directions


All content posted by the user in the form of Offers/Products/Company Profiles/Images etc. is the responsibility of the user and Stayin.us shall not be held liable for any such content in any way.